Strike.TV, conceived during the Writers Guild of America strike last December, has launched with more than a dozen original pieces from well-known writers, directors and actors including The Daily
Show's Rob Kutner (writer) and Aasif Mandvi (actor), actor Bob Newhart and Writer/Director Steven E. de Souza (Lara Croft Tomb Raider: The Cradle of Life, Beverly Hills Cop 2, Commando).
The Web site, http://www.strike.tv, will donate the first three months of advertising revenue from projects to the Entertainment Assistance Program of The Actors Fund, which assists film and
television crew members affected by the work stoppage.
Strike.TV continues to incubate projects, offering creators and participants creative freedom, retainership of material and help in
monetizing and distributing work across the Web.
